PORT CHESTER, NY — Noted sociologist Robert N. Bellah wrote,"One of the keys to the survival of free institutions is the relationship between private and public life, the way citizens do, or do not, participate in the public sphere."
There are plenty of upcoming chances to help tend to our democracy close to the roots. Several public meetings are scheduled for this week in Port Chester.

- Board of Trustees Meeting - Feb. 6, 6:30 p.m., Town of Rye Justice Courtroom, 350 N. Main St., Port Chester
- Taxi Commission Meeting - Feb. 7, 6:30 p.m., Village Hall Conference Room, 222 Grace Church St., Port Chester
Port Chester Industrial Development Agency (PCIDA) Regular Meeting - Feb. 8, 6:30 p.m.CANCELED- Park Commission Meeting - Feb. 8, 7 p.m., 220 Grace Church St., Port Chester
